Overnight oats are a no-cook, make-ahead breakfast that combines rolled oats, milk, fruit, and seeds in a mason jar and chills overnight. The result is a creamy, fiber-rich bowl ready to eat straight from the fridge.
1/4 cup quick oats (I prefer organic, you can use gluten-free, or protein oats)
1/2 cup milk (use milk of choice)
1/2 medium banana (sliced (use the other half as a topping))
1/2 tbsp chia seeds
1/2 cup blueberries (divided)
monk fruit sweetener (stevia, or your favorite sweetener, to taste)
pinch cinnamon
1 tbsp chopped pecans (or any nuts or seeds)

Instructions
1
Place all the ingredient in a jar, shake, cover and refrigerate overnight.
2
The next morning, add your favorite crunchy toppings such as nuts, granola, etc and enjoy!

Tips & Notes
Pro tips
Use a 1:2 ratio of oats to milk as a base; thicker consistency needs more oats or chia seeds, thinner needs more milk.
Slice banana and layer it directly in the jar with oats and milk so it softens and flavors the base overnight.
Divide blueberries: stir half into the base, reserve half for topping to maintain texture and color.
Let the jar sit at least 4 hours, preferably overnight, so oats fully hydrate and reach a creamy consistency.
Substitutions
Quick oats → rolled oats (will require extra soak time, up to 12 hours) or steel-cut oats (requires 24+ hours)
Banana → diced apple, pear, or peach (stir into base for overnight softening)
Blueberries → raspberries, strawberries, or blackberries (use fresh or frozen)
Pecans → almonds, walnuts, sunflower seeds, or pumpkin seeds (stir in or top)
Storage & make-ahead
Store in an airtight mason jar in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Eat cold straight from the jar or transfer to a bowl and microwave 30–60 seconds to warm.
Equipment
mason jar (quart or pint size)
Common Questions
Can I make overnight oats without chia seeds?
Yes. Chia seeds add thickness and nutrition, but you can omit them or substitute ground flaxseed, psyllium husk, or extra oats for similar texture.
How long do overnight oats last in the fridge?
Store in an airtight mason jar for up to 5 days. Add toppings (nuts, fresh fruit) just before eating to prevent sogginess.
What milk works best for overnight oats?
Any milk—dairy, almond, oat, or coconut—works. Creamier options like whole milk or oat milk yield thicker results; thinner milks stay more liquid.
Do I need to cook the oats?
No. Quick oats soften fully overnight when soaked in cold milk, requiring no cooking or heating.
Can I scale this recipe?
Yes. The 1:2 ratio of oats to milk is flexible. Double or halve all ingredients and adjust sweetener to taste.
